'Convergence on the 42nd Parallel' is finished and I'm currently (as of June 2021) preparing it for production and marketing. It's due to be published on 21 October 2021.
The first draft of my second book - an aviation / medical novella titled 'O2' - is nearly complete.
Book 3 - a thriller set on the sea and coastline of Tasmania - is at the planning and early research stage.
Book 4 - a novel about the inside workings of the Christian 'super-church' business is at the early concept stage.
Book 5 ? who knows! :)

It happened twenty years ago during a conversation with a work colleague. We were looking out at the river - right at the spot where the book reaches its climatic ending. Ever since then, the story and characters have been bubbling away in my head (and even in my dreams!). In 2019 I couldn't hold it back any longer and started to plot it out and write.
